Table 7

Comparison between the observed and the RADEX-MCMC best-fitted model parameters(a) predicted HeH+ line fluxes.

HeH+ Lines (υ′, J′) → (υ, J) Rest wavelength (μm) Upper state energy / kg (K) Observed line flux (10−18 Wm−2) Predicted line flux (by RADEX-MCMC)W (10−18 Wm−2) Ratio (Observed / Predicted)
(0,1 → 0,0) 149.091 96.5 163 ± 32 171.60 0.95 ± 0.186
(1,0 → 0,1)[P(1)] 3.51532 4188.3 1.55 ± 0.16 1.80 0.86 ± 0.089
(1,1 → 0,2)[P(2)] 3.60677 4276.9 2.08 ± 0.31 1.92 1.08 ± 0.161

Notes. (*)RADEX line flux is given erg s−1 cm−2. To compare with the observed flux, we convert the RADEX flux unit to W m−2 and accounting for the observational angular sizes (see notes in Table 3). (a)RADEX-MCMC best-fitted model parameters from Table 6: Tkin = 2455 K, n(e) = 1.45 × 105 cm−3, n(H) = 6.61 × 104 cm−3, N[HeH+] = 2.04 × 1012 cm−2, line width = 30 km s−1.
